ajinampi

ajina

nt

  1. ajina (nt): animal hide; fur; lit. from goat
  2. ajina (nt): black antelope hide; lit. from goat
  3. ajina (masc): cheetah
  4. ajinanta (prp): not conquering; not defeating; (comm) not causing financial loss
  5. ajini (aor): overpowered; robbed; defeated
  6. ajina (masc): name of an arahant monk; lit. black antelope hide

Analysis. ajinaṃ + api; ajina + api

Etymology. √aj + a + ina; from √aj 'go, drive'; Sanskrit ajina [aj]
